Lot 261    

Post Office Dept., 1873, 30¢ black, strip of five with right selvage, tied by quartered cork cancels duplexed with "Washington D.C., Dec" cds on large manila Post Office Department, Office of Third Assistant Postmaster General envelope to the Postmaster at Winchester N.H. prepaying; couple small stamp flaws and minor left edge restoration, Very Fine and choice.
Scott No. O55    Estimate $10,000 - 15,000.

THE ONLY RECORDED 30¢ POST OFFICE COVER, THE HIGHEST POST OFFICE VALUE ON COVER. A STUNNING DEPARTMENTAL OFFICIAL COVER.

The other recorded 30¢ Post Office stamp used on cover, is actually used on a large piece that has been deemed a fake by experts. There are no 24¢ or 90¢ Post Office covers recorded.

Realized: $13,500
